AI agents, or agentic AI, are increasingly being considered for roles within the workforce. These autonomous systems are designed to operate independently, making decisions and performing tasks without constant human intervention. As companies explore the potential of AI agents, they face both opportunities and challenges in integrating these systems into the workforce.
The Promise of AI Agents in the Workforce
AI agents offer the promise of increased productivity and efficiency in the workplace.
By automating repetitive and low-risk tasks, these systems can free up human workers to focus on more complex and creative endeavors. Proponents argue that AI agents can enhance personal and economic productivity, foster innovation, and liberate users from monotonous tasks.
Several CEOs of major tech companies have expressed optimism about the future of AI agents in the workforce. In early 2025, they predicted that AI agents would eventually join the workforce, taking on roles that require decision-making and problem-solving capabilities. This vision aligns with the broader push by Big Tech companies to automate various aspects of business operations.
Challenges and Limitations
Despite the potential benefits, AI agents face significant challenges in the workforce. A preprint study by Carnegie Mellon University revealed that AI agents struggled to complete a majority of assigned tasks in a simulated software company. Similar findings were reported with other agents in business settings and freelance work, indicating that these systems are not yet ready to fully replace human workers.
Concerns about liability, ethical challenges, and AI safety also pose obstacles to the widespread adoption of AI agents. Issues such as data privacy, weakened human oversight, and the lack of guaranteed repeatability further complicate the integration of these systems into the workforce. Additionally, the potential for job displacement and underemployment raises important social and economic questions.
The Path Forward
To address these challenges, ongoing research and development are essential. Companies and researchers are exploring ways to improve the reliability and effectiveness of AI agents, focusing on areas such as memory systems, cognitive architecture, and orchestration patterns. Efforts to standardize inter-agent communication and enhance security and compliance frameworks are also underway.
